    Ultrex Quest Ethernet?

    About to rig my boat with a new quest. What are the benefits of connecting Ethernet to graphs? Are you guys using those features. Thank you

    The Ethernet connection allows you to operate your trolling motor from your control head. I use the Minn Kota sidebar to control my Ulterra Quest all the time, including things like Cruise Control, Autopilot, and follow the contour olerations.

    You can see the spot lock waypoint set as well as follow contours, set a route, etc. iPilot Link and Advanced GPS have lots of good features.
